DF005 – DF10  
1.0A GLASS PASSIVATED BRIDGE RECTIFIER  
Features  
!
Glass Passivated Die Construction  
!
!
!
!
!
Low Forward Voltage Drop  
High Current Capability  
High Surge Current Capability  
Designed for Surface Mount Application  
Plastic Material – UL Recognition Flammability  
Classification 94V-O

Case: Molded Plastic  
Terminals: Plated Leads Solderable per  
MIL-STD-202, Method 208  
Polarity: As Marked on Case  
Weight: 0.38 grams (approx.)  
Mounting Position: Any
